Ghosts or Gods, I Run 'Em All

Labeled a zero-mana loser, a delivery boy stumbles into a supernatural bureau. Yet, a terrifying Ghost Queen claims him as her husband, a nine-tailed fox shields him, and the icy boss demands his company! Jealous, an arrogant heir unleashes a doomsday spell. As gods despair, the "loser" stops it with one finger. Who is he really?
